$(document).ready(function () {
  function addText(selector,thisS,endTag) {
      var text = $(thisS).attr("class").substr(7);
      if(endTag==undefined) endTag = ""; 
      
      attr = "";
      
      if(endTag == "") {
      
        if(text=="url") {
          var url = prompt ("Zadejte URL:");          
          attr = "="+url;          
        } else if (text=="img") {
          var img = prompt ("Zadejte adresu obrázku:");
          attr = "="+img;        
        } else if (text=="imgl") {
          var imgl = prompt ("Zadejte adresu obrázku:");
          attr = "="+imgl;        
        } else if (text=="imgr") {
          var imgr = prompt ("Zadejte adresu obrázku:");
          attr = "="+imgr;        
        }
        
        if (attr=="=" || attr=="=null") attr = "";
        
      }
      
      
      var val = $(selector).val(); 
      $(selector).val(val+"["+endTag+text+attr+"]");
      $("#msg").focus();  
  }

  $("#editor.buttons").show();
  $("#editor.buttons img").toggle(
    function () {
      $(this).css({"border":"2px red solid"});    
            
      addText("#msg",this);      
    },
    function () {
      $(this).css({"border":""});     
      addText("#msg",this,"/");
    }
  );
  
  $("#msg").select(function () { 
    /*-var sl = (this.value).substring(this.selectionStart,this.selectionEnd);  
    #sl.wrap("<div>");-*/
  });
});
